Host Lineage: Natranaerobius thermophilus; Natranaerobius; Natranaerobiaceae; Natranaerobiales; Firmicutes; Bacteria

General Information: Natranaerobius thermophilus is a halophilic, alkalithermophilic bacterium isolated from saline lakes in the Wadi El Natrun depression, Egypt.
